Tectonic constraints on 1.3~1.2 Ga final breakup of Columbia supercontinent from a giant radiating dyke swarm

The 1.3- 1.2 Ga fan- shaped Mackenzie dyke swarm and other similar- aged dyke swarms in the Canadian Shield constitute the subswarms of a Late Mesoproterozoic giant radiating swarm. The Late Mesoproterozoic mafic dyke swarms in Australia and East Antarct
